What matters under the hood
We use a carbon fiber or quartz infrared element to turn electricity into focused warmth. The payoff is quick—often noticeable within seconds—and coverage that reaches across the floor and seating area without hot and cold spots. Many models run on 12V or 24V DC, pulling 300–600W, so they can be powered off the caravan’s house battery without tripping over the system limits. Add a built-in thermostat and tip-over protection, and you get steady heat with a safety net. If you run into wet conditions, look for an IP rating that confirms protection against splashes and condensation.
Why this approach fits a caravan
Space is tight, and insulation is always a compromise. Convection heaters send warm air up and leave the floor cold; infrared warms people and objects directly, so you feel cozy even when the air itself is still cool. That translates to quicker warm-ups, less draw on the battery, and fewer temperature swings between the stove, the seats, and the bed. It also stops cold surfaces from radiating chill back at you—something you really notice when you’re eating, working, or heading in for the night.
The practical details you can’t skip
Plan the wiring from day one. A 12V heater at 600W pulls about 50A, so you need properly sized wiring, a correctly matched fuse, and enough battery capacity for the runtime you want. **Position the unit so the beam spreads across the main living zone, and keep it clear of fabrics and anything flammable.**For the best overall comfort, pair the infrared heater with an interior fan or a small convection boost to mix the air—without losing that direct radiant warmth.
